titleOfInvention Adhesive patch for mycosis
abstract An adhesive patch for application to a nail and/or the skin for the prevention or treatment of mycosis. It can maintain a high drug concentration in the nail and/or horny layer of the skin for long without the aid of a dissolving agent for preventing drug crystallization/precipitation or an accelerator for accelerating drug penetration into the nail and/or skin. It has excellent adhesion even in long-term wear, and is less irritative to the skin. The adhesive patch, which is for application to a nail and/or the skin for the prevention or treatment of mycosis, comprises an acrylic pressure-sensitive adhesive layer or silicone pressure-sensitive adhesive layer, and the adhesive layer contains an antifungal agent having an octanol-water partition coefficient, logKo/w, of 4 or higher, the antifungal agent being contained in a dissolved state.
